Why should you have a loyalty program in your customer retention strategy?

As part of any business’ customer retention strategies, loyalty programs are one of the most effective tactics for increasing revenue and inspiring customer loyalty.

Market research found that 84% of consumers say they’re more apt to stick with a brand that offers a loyalty program.

At the same time, 66% of customers expressed that the ability to earn rewards changes their spending behavior.

Simply stating, you shouldn’t forget about your loyal customers in the process. After all, they’re the ones who have contributed to your success.

With your customer loyalty program, you can reward customers for their continued support and trust in your brand.

It encourages them to shop and interact with your business while at the same time, they are being rewarded.

This makes them happier because they’re getting more from experience than just your product or service.

And, since the top percentile of your customers spends much more than the rest of your customer base, you have to make sure these users are more than satisfied.

Brands that implement QR Code-based loyalty programs

1. Amazon’s SmileCodes users scan to get discounts and other offers

Poster QR code

Amazon distributed its branded QR codes SmileCodes to various pop-up shops and Amazon lockers in Europe and US magazines.

Customers who scan the codes using the Amazon app can instantly unlock Amazon benefits and discounts at the specific location they find the code.

2. Promo QR code used by GCash

One of the largest Philippine mobile wallets, mobile payments, and branchless banking service providers, GCash, uses QR codes to give customers exclusive vouchers, which they can use to get discounts when paying using the scan to pay GCash QR.

When customers scan the QR code, they’ll automatically receive a QR Voucher.

They’ll get it through the app, and they’ll also receive an SMS with your voucher details — how much the voucher is, how long it is valid for, and where they can use it.

3. Target uses QR codes to offer substitute gift cards

Target, one of the largest retailers in the US, creatively debuted its Gift Cards All Gone QR-Code campaign.

When scanners scan the QR code, they will be redirected to Target’s gift cards online stock or substitute.
